Output 21c86f1c1019b425c5d4012b490ee5a8fbe1ebd5d67ed79c8b3a23668bd77877: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df046869d612feb95f24241fd63bf63f9be6ca53 OP_EQUAL
address
3N2DtavksH4UscShMn8YmGAoBZZ549dD5X
transaction
21c86f1c1019b425c5d4012b490ee5a8fbe1ebd5d67ed79c8b3a23668bd77877
spent
true